Each variety carries the same construction requirements but offers a different benefit. The horn's type must be determined at creation and cannot later be changed. If the horn is random, roll a d4 to determine which type of horn it is. A horn of plenty may be blown once per week of downtime to improve the rate at which its bearer can exchange capital. On command, a horn of plentiful goods, labor, or influence allows a creature to trade any 2 points of a single type of capital in exchange for 1 point of either Goods, Labor, or Influence, as indicated by the item's name. (For instance, a horn of plentiful goods allows a creature to trade 2 points of any one kind of capital for 1 point of Goods.) This effect lasts for 1 day. If you are already trading two single types of capital for one other type of capital, at the GM's discretion, blowing the horn allows you to trade on a 1-to-1 basis. A horn of plentiful magic acts similarly to the aforementioned horns, but instead allows a character to trade 3 points of either Goods, Labor, or Influence for 1 point of Magic.
